Understanding Exercise Cycles
Exercise cycles, likewise known as stationary bikes, are designed to mimic the experience of riding a standard bicycle, however in a stationary setting. They can be found in various types, each catering to different fitness goals and preferences. The main types of exercise cycles consist of:

Upright Bikes: These closely resemble a basic bicycle and are perfect for those who prefer a more traditional cycling experience. They offer a variety of resistance levels and can be utilized for cardio exercises, interval training, and basic fitness.

Recumbent Bikes: These bikes feature a reclined seat and a more unwinded posture, making them excellent for individuals with back or knee problems. Recumbent bikes often come with extra functions like back assistance and a more comfy seat, making them ideal for longer, low-impact workouts.

Spin Bikes: Popular in studio cycling classes, spin bikes are developed for high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and provide a more vigorous exercise. They typically have heavier flywheels and a range of resistance settings, enabling a vibrant and engaging exercise experience.

Indoor Cycling Bikes: These resemble spin bikes however are generally more inexpensive and designed for home use. They offer a robust and long lasting style, making them perfect for regular, extreme workouts.

Dual Action Bikes: These bikes incorporate upper body resistance in addition to the lower body exercise. They are best for those who want a full-body exercise service.

Benefits of Using an Exercise Cycle
Before diving into the specifics of picking an exercise cycle, it's important to understand the numerous advantages they offer:

Cardiovascular Health: Regular biking can enhance heart health, lower blood pressure, and improve general cardiovascular fitness.
Weight Management: Cycling burns calories and helps in weight reduction or weight maintenance.
Low-Impact Exercise: Exercise cycles are mild on the joints, making them ideal for people of any ages and physical fitness levels.
Benefit: With a home exercise cycle, you can work out at any time without the need to travel to a fitness center.
Personalized Workouts: Most exercise cycles come with adjustable resistance settings and different workout programs, allowing you to tailor your regular to your specific objectives.
Elements to Consider When Buying an Exercise Cycle
Picking the right exercise cycle can be frustrating offered the wide variety of choices offered. Here are some essential elements to think about:

Fitness Goals:

Cardio Focused: If your main objective is to improve cardiovascular fitness, an upright or spin bike may be the very best option.
Rehabilitation or Low-Impact: For those with joint discomfort or recovering from injuries, a recumbent bike is preferable.
Full-Body Workout: Dual action bikes are perfect for those aiming to engage both upper and lower body muscles.
Budget:

Entry-level bikes can vary from $100 to $300.
Mid-range bikes, which use more features and better build quality, usually cost in between $300 and $700.
High-end bikes, often discovered in gyms, can cost over $700 and offer advanced functions like smart connection and interactive programs.
Space Availability:

Compact Bikes: Some bikes are developed to be compact and collapsible, making them perfect for studio apartments or homes with limited space.
Large Bikes: If you have adequate space, you may think about a bigger, more robust bike with extra functions.
Convenience and Ergonomics:

Seat: Ensure the seat is comfortable and adjustable to fit your height and posture.
Handlebars: Look for handlebars that use numerous grip positions to lower stress on your hands and wrists.

Connectivity and Features:

Smart Bikes: These bikes can link to your smart device or tablet, providing interactive workouts, real-time tracking, and combination with physical fitness apps.
Show Screen: A high-quality display screen can enhance your exercise experience by providing feedback on your performance, such as range, speed, and calories burned.
Entertainment Options: Some bikes feature integrated speakers, USB ports, or home entertainment systems to keep you encouraged throughout long exercises.

Frequently Asked Questions About Exercise Cycles
What is the best exercise cycle for newbies?

For newbies, an upright bike with several resistance levels and a comfy seat is often advised. Brands like Sunny Health & Fitness and ProForm use cost effective choices that are simple to use.
Just how much area do I require for an exercise cycle?

Many exercise cycles require a minimum of a 5x5-foot area for safe and comfortable usage. If space is restricted, think about a compact or foldable bike.
Can I use an exercise cycle if I have knee or back problems?

Yes, recumbent bikes are particularly created to be mild on the joints and supply back assistance, making them an exceptional choice for individuals with knee or back issues.
How frequently should I maintain my exercise cycle?

Regular maintenance, such as lubricating the chain, inspecting the tension, and cleaning up the bike, is essential for optimal efficiency. Most manufacturers suggest a maintenance check every 6-12 months.
Are wise exercise cycles worth the investment?

Smart exercise cycles can significantly enhance your workout experience with interactive classes, real-time tracking, and customized training. If you are devoted to your fitness journey, the investment can be extremely advantageous.
